Well I've been having some serious problems for a week now, windows has been freezing and crashing all over the place.

http://www.techsupportforum.com/forums/f299/random-hangs-on-a-fresh-format-637725.html

Long story short, I might have isolated the problem. CPU-Z shows the core voltage as 1.856v, while BIOS shows it as 1.38v. I've been searching around and it seems that the norm is 1.4v not OC'd.

Now, if this is the problem, I have no idea how to fix it, the BIOS only allows me to increase the voltage by small increments, not freely adjust it. I'm not overclocked at all currently if that helps.

If it means anything, before I recently formatted I used AMD Overdrive's auto-tune feature, and I suspect that's what caused the problem in the first place.
